#3e8992 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e8992 is composed of 24.3% red, 53.7%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.5% cyan, 6.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 186.4 degrees, a saturation of 40.4% and a lightness of 40.8%. #3e8992 color hex could be obtained by blending #7cffff with #001325.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#3e8992 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e8992 has RGB values of R:62, G:137,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 4098450.

Shades and Tints of #3e8992
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040808 is the darkest color, while #fafc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e8992
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666a6a is the less saturated color, while #06b5ca is the most saturated one.
